The Global PS&R Manager – Water role is responsible for managing, maintaining and improving the Water business’s product stewardship, and regulatory processes per expectations established in DuPont Corporate Standards and aligned to the Product Safety Code of Responsible Care®.
The Global PS&R Manager leads a team focused on managing the Water Business’s product’s health, safety, and environmental impacts throughout their lifecycle. The product portfolio includes Reverse Osmosis, Nanofiltration and Ultrafiltration Membranes as well as Ion Exchange Resins. These products are used in a variety of applications including drinking water production and food contact use where region specific certifications and regulatory processes are managed.
